diff --git a/src/openvpn/ssl.c b/src/openvpn/ssl.c index 85016937b4d..fc39af8f4dd 100644 --- a/src/openvpn/ssl.c +++ b/src/openvpn/ssl.c @@ -1054,7 +1054,7 @@ tls_session_free(struct tls_session *session, bool clear) /* we don't need clear=true for this call since * the structs are part of session and get cleared * as part of session */ - key_state_free(&session->key[i], false); + key_state_free(&session->key[i], true); } free(session->common_name);